  3. 5 minutes ago, Belo said:

    bear's eating berries are delicious. Those eating dump or fish, not so much. Just about any meat is decent in sausage though. Just test for parasites or cook real well. Bear grease rendered from the fat is also highly sought after. 

    When do you harvest the fat? Do you scrape it off when skinning? I have seen some videos on skinning or gutting bears but it never shows fat harvest. Should I get one, I'd like to keep that fat.

  4. In NY scent lures are legal as is calling. You could try either or both. I know one fellow on another forum who has drawn bears in with scent lures near NJ border but yes it's low %.

    Only bear I have seen was by chance and I bolted as soon as I snapped a twig and it saw me.

    The Ultimate Guide to Black Bear Hunting by Douglas Boze has a chapter on calling which he likes a lot. He hunts in WA state.
